Latest Patents
Francois Black's latest patents include a "Method and device for initiating an explosive train." This detonator device features a mechanism that allows it to shift between an out-of-line orientation, where initiation does not trigger the explosive train, and an in-line orientation, where initiation does result in activation. Another significant patent is for "Wellbore perforating devices," which disclose a design that includes a plurality of shaped charges held in a manner that allows them to intersect a common plane upon detonation.
